A calculation of the three-dimensional structure of coronal rays is ca
rried out. We used two photographs obtained in observations along the
band of the eclipse of July 11, 1991. The time interval was 3h15m, the
angle of Sun's rotation phi = 1.-degree8. It is shown that in the cas
e of small angles, the method of calculations does not depend on assum
ptions about the nature of the ray structures: they may be lines in th
e three-dimensional space (such are probably polar ''brushes'') or the
totality of points of tangency of the magnetic surfaces with the line
of sight. The helm-like structures are projected pleats of magnetic s
urfaces.
